چکیده مقاله:
Interaction of humans and computer agents should be harmonized by adapting the utomation level of IT systems, to maintain a high performance for the system, in the changing environmental condition . This research presents an expert system for realization of adaptive autonomy (AA), using deterministic time Petri nets (DTPNs), referred to as AAPNES. The design is based on the practical list of environmental conditions nd superior expert`s judgments. As revealed by the results, the presented AAPNES can effectively determine the proper level of automation for the changing performance shaping factors of human-automation interaction systems in the smart grid.
